Don Fallis has authored 77 papers that have received a total of 1.3k indexed citations.
This includes 44 papers in Philosophy, 26 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 17 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ience. The topics of these papers are Epistemology, Ethics, and Metaphysics (43 papers), Misinformation and Its Impacts (14 papers) and Psychology of Moral and Emotional Judgment (14 papers). Don Fallis is often cited by papers focused on Epistemology, Ethics, and Metaphysics (43 papers), Misinformation and Its Impacts (14 papers) and Psychology of Moral and Emotional Judgment (14 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States and Mexico. Don Fallis's co-authors include Martin Frické, Peter J. Lewis, Kay Mathiesen, Terry Horgan and John L. Pollock and has published in prestigious journals such as The American Journal of Medicine, Journal of the American Medical Informatics Association and American Mathematical Monthly.
